Recently I've observed that the power query same times stroked when i refersh it, after searching i found that the microsoft mashup evaluation container not working nurmally, so i need help to fix this issue please ASAP.
Please note that my PC processor Intel Core i7 8th Gen with 16 G RAM.

You just need to be on the lastest version of the desktop. Close the desktop and make sure there are no mashup apps in memory to ensure none have died and been left there. You can see that in the Task Manager.
If it keeps locking up, you need to go into Power Query and refresh each query and see which queries are causing it and go from there. There isn't an easy way to diagnose this, but I can say, from anecdotal evidence of my own use, I've seen no mashup engine crashes either in Excel or Power BI Desktop in the last 2-3 months that indicate a broad bug. But it could be and just not on data sources I use. I stick to CSV, Excel, and SQL sources predominantly.
